Understanding Charitable Trusts

A charitable trust is a legal arrangement that allows you to benefit charitable causes while preserving assets for your heirs.

There are several forms—each with different tax advantages and control provisions. We explain options and tailor them to your objectives.

Definition and Explanation of Charitable Trusts

A charitable trust is a trust established to support a charitable purpose. Assets are managed by a trustee and distributed according to the terms, with potential tax benefits under California law.

Key Elements and Processes

Typical elements include the trust agreement, appointed trustees, named beneficiaries, and a funding plan. The process involves drafting, funding, and coordinating administration and tax reporting.

Key Terms and Glossary

A glossary helps you understand common terms used in charitable trust planning and how they apply to your strategy.

Charitable Trust

A charitable trust is a trust established to benefit a charitable purpose or organization, with assets managed by a trustee under specified terms.

Donor Advised Fund

A donor advised fund is a charitable giving account you contribute to and from which you recommend grants over time.

Charitable Remainder Trust

A charitable remainder trust provides income to noncharitable beneficiaries during a period, with the remaining assets benefiting charity.

Tax Benefits of Charitable Giving

Tax benefits may include income tax deductions and potential estate tax savings when the trust is properly funded and maintained.

What is a charitable trust and how does it work?

A charitable trust is a legal arrangement designed to benefit a charitable purpose. It involves a trustee who manages assets and follows the terms set by the donor. This structure can provide ongoing support to charities while enabling you to retain influence over how and when gifts are made.
